@Generated(value="software.amazon.awssdk:codegen") public final class DeleteRumMetricsDestinationRequest extends RumRequest implements ToCopyableBuilder<DeleteRumMetricsDestinationRequest.Builder,DeleteRumMetricsDestinationRequest>
| Modifier and Type | Class and Description |
|---|---|
static interface |
DeleteRumMetricsDestinationRequest.Builder |
| Modifier and Type | Method and Description |
|---|---|
String |
appMonitorName()
The name of the app monitor that is sending metrics to the destination that you want to delete.
|
static DeleteRumMetricsDestinationRequest.Builder |
builder() |
MetricDestination |
destination()
The type of destination to delete.
|
String |
destinationArn()
This parameter is required if
Destination is Evidently. |
String |
destinationAsString()
The type of destination to delete.
|
boolean |
equals(Object obj) |
boolean |
equalsBySdkFields(Object obj) |
<T> Optional<T> |
getValueForField(String fieldName,
Class<T> clazz) |
int |
hashCode() |
List<SdkField<?>> |
sdkFields() |
static Class<? extends DeleteRumMetricsDestinationRequest.Builder> |
serializableBuilderClass() |
DeleteRumMetricsDestinationRequest.Builder |
toBuilder() |
String |
toString()
Returns a string representation of this object.
|
overrideConfigurationclone, finalize, getClass, notify, notifyAll, wait, wait, waitcopypublic final String appMonitorName()
The name of the app monitor that is sending metrics to the destination that you want to delete.
public final MetricDestination destination()
The type of destination to delete. Valid values are CloudWatch and Evidently.
If the service returns an enum value that is not available in the current SDK version, destination will
return MetricDestination.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available from
destinationAsString().
CloudWatch and Evidently.MetricDestinationpublic final String destinationAsString()
The type of destination to delete. Valid values are CloudWatch and Evidently.
If the service returns an enum value that is not available in the current SDK version, destination will
return MetricDestination.UNKNOWN_TO_SDK_VERSION. The raw value returned by the service is available from
destinationAsString().
CloudWatch and Evidently.MetricDestinationpublic final String destinationArn()
This parameter is required if Destination is Evidently. If Destination is
CloudWatch, do not use this parameter. This parameter specifies the ARN of the Evidently experiment
that corresponds to the destination to delete.
Destination is Evidently. If
Destination is CloudWatch, do not use this parameter. This parameter specifies
the ARN of the Evidently experiment that corresponds to the destination to delete.public DeleteRumMetricsDestinationRequest.Builder toBuilder()
toBuilder in interface ToCopyableBuilder<DeleteRumMetricsDestinationRequest.Builder,DeleteRumMetricsDestinationRequest>toBuilder in class RumRequestpublic static DeleteRumMetricsDestinationRequest.Builder builder()
public static Class<? extends DeleteRumMetricsDestinationRequest.Builder> serializableBuilderClass()
public final int hashCode()
hashCode in class AwsRequestpublic final boolean equals(Object obj)
equals in class AwsRequestpublic final boolean equalsBySdkFields(Object obj)
equalsBySdkFields in interface SdkPojopublic final String toString()
public final <T> Optional<T> getValueForField(String fieldName, Class<T> clazz)
getValueForField in class SdkRequestCopyright © 2023. All rights reserved.